Harris County Jail does not offer regular in-person visitation on Mondays. Visits are generally available Tuesday through Sunday from 1 to 5 p.m. and 7:30 to 10 p.m., but your actual visitation day depends on the inmate's facility and floor or pod. Because inmates can be transferred, always verify the person's current housing location before scheduling a visit.
Visiting an inmate in Harris County requires knowing exactly where the person is housed. A transfer to another floor, jail building, or contract facility can change the visitation schedule and available options.
Overcrowding means that some inmates are housed in contract jails outside Harris County. They may be housed in Beaumont or even out of state in Louisiana or Mississippi.
If this happens, online visitation may be your only realistic option.

Harris County Jail Visitation Schedule
According to the Harris County Sheriff's Office's current visitation schedule, visiting hours are available six days a week (no regular in-person visits on Monday) from 1 p.m. to 5 p.m. and 7:30 p.m. to 10 p.m. The last scheduled visit will begin at 9:30 p.m.
How Does Harris County Decide What Day You Can Visit?
When you can visit is complicated. It will depend on where the inmate is currently housed, based on the facility, floor, or pod.
| Jail facility | 1200 Baker St. | 701 N. San Jacinto St | 711 N. San Jacinto St |
| Day | Floor | Floor | Pod |
| Tues. | 1, 6 | 2, 7 | A-1 |
| Wed. | 2, 5 | 3, 6 | B-1 |
| Thurs. | 3, 4 | 4, 5 | A-1 |
| Fri. | 4, 3 | 5, 4 | B-1 |
| Sat. | 5, 2 | 6, 3 | A-1 |
| Sun. | 6, 1 | 7, 2 | B-1 |
How to Schedule an In-Person Inmate Visit
All visitors must register via the scheduling app or upon arrival at the jail facility. After registration, visits may be scheduled up to seven days in advance. Visits will last 20 minutes. You must arrive 30 minutes before your scheduled visit for ID verification.
A printed confirmation is required. If you don’t have a printer, you can print the document at the Visitor Control Center.
All visitors must:
- Be at least 17 years of age
- Have a valid government ID
An inmate may receive a maximum of two visitors per visit. If one visitor is 16 or younger, the other visitor must be 17 or older. The adult must present valid photo identification.

Can You Visit a Harris County Inmate Online?
Remote video visitation through Harris County is currently available only for inmates housed at 700 N. San Jacinto. If the inmate is housed at another Harris County facility or an out-of-county contract jail, different visitation options and providers may apply.
Video visits can be a lifeline for friends and family members. Due to overcrowding, some inmates are housed as far away as Mississippi, making regular visits difficult.
Standard Harris County Jail in-person visits and remote Securus visits are generally 20 minutes. Contract-jail visitation periods vary by facility.
If your friend or family member is housed outside of Harris County, contact that facility for the most up-to-date information.
Assume non-attorney jail communications are monitored and may be recorded. Do not discuss the facts of a pending criminal case, alleged conduct, defenses, witnesses, or anything else that could be used as evidence. Attorney-client communications are subject to different rules.

What if the Inmate Is Housed Outside Harris County?
Because of overcrowding, Harris County houses some inmates in contract facilities outside the county. This means your friend or family member could be housed as far away as Tutwiler, Mississippi, making in-person visitation difficult.
Contract Jail Visitation Schedule
Housing locations and visitation schedules can change. Confirm the inmate's current facility before making travel arrangements.
LaSalle Jefferson County Jail (Beaumont, TX):
Visitation is permitted:
Monday: 1:00 p.m. – 4:00 p.m.
Wednesday: 8:30 a.m. – 12:30 p.m.
Friday: 8:30 a.m. – 12:30 p.m.
There is no visitation on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day, or Sunday.
Call (409) 434-4653 Monday through Friday from 8 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. to schedule an appointment.
LaSalle Correctional Center (Olla, Louisiana)
For Harris County inmates housed at LaSalle Correctional Center in Olla, in-person visits must be scheduled at least 24 hours in advance and are available at 12:30 p.m. or 2:30 p.m., Saturday through Wednesday, with no visits on Thursday or Friday. Sessions can last one hour, with a maximum of two visits per week.
LaSalle Natchitoches Parish Detention Center (Louisiana)
All visits must be scheduled 24 hours in advance. There is no visitation on Tuesday, Saturday, or Sunday.
Visitation is permitted:
Monday: 1 p.m. to 4 p.m.
Wednesday: 8:30 to 10:30 a.m. and 1 p.m. to 4 p.m.
Thursday: 8:30 to 10:30 a.m. and 1 p.m. to 4 p.m.
Friday: 8:30 to 10:30 a.m. and 1 p.m. to 4 p.m.
Call (318) 357-9300 between 8 a.m. and 4:30 p.m. Monday through Friday to schedule an appointment.
Tallahatchie County Correctional Facility (Tutwiler, Mississippi)
Call (662) 345-6567 to confirm current in-person visitation procedures before traveling. Remote tablet visitation is also available through the facility's video visitation portal.
What Do You Need to Visit an Inmate?
Visitors must register before the visit and arrive 30 minutes early for ID verification. Adults must bring a valid government-issued photo ID and a printed visit confirmation. If you do not have a printer, you can print the confirmation at the Visitor Control Center.
Harris County Jail Dress Code
Harris County Jail enforces a visitor dress code. If your clothing violates the policy, visitation may be denied. Harris County Jail will not allow:
- Revealing or transparent garments
- Sleeves shorter than halfway down the upper arm
- Spandex or tights without a skirt or shorts
- Skirts, dresses, or shorts that are above mid-thigh
- Clothing that displays obscene or offensive language, drawings, or a gang affiliation
Assessing what’s appropriate can be subjective, so don’t take any risks. If you don’t know whether an article of clothing is acceptable, choose something else.
What Items Are Prohibited?
Storage lockers are available, and only the locker key is permitted.
Purses, wallets, bags, mobile phones, recording devices, writing instruments, weapons, etc., all must be placed in the locker. No packages, mail, or photos may be given to the inmate. Food and drinks are not permitted.
What Happens if You Violate Visitation Rules?
Harris County may deny, revoke, limit, suspend, or terminate visitation privileges if visitors do not follow jail rules or misuse the visitation system. Bringing or attempting to provide prohibited substances or items to an inmate can also result in criminal consequences.
Verify the Inmate's Location Before You Visit
Harris County inmates may be transferred between local jail buildings or to contract facilities in Texas, Louisiana, or Mississippi. A transfer can change the visitation schedule, location, and remote-visit options.
Because jail housing assignments and visitation schedules can change, verify current information with the Harris County Sheriff's Office or the contract facility before traveling.
